Around the Lead of High Quality: Enhancing Examination Monitoring with the Power of AI
Around the Lead of High Quality: Enhancing Examination Monitoring with the Power of AI
Blog Article
With today's swiftly advancing software program growth landscape, the stress to deliver top quality applications at rate is relentless. Standard test administration techniques, often strained by manual procedures and large volume, struggle to keep pace. Nevertheless, a transformative pressure is emerging to reinvent just how we guarantee software high quality: Artificial Intelligence (AI). By strategically incorporating AI testing and leveraging advanced AI screening tools, companies can dramatically boost their test monitoring capabilities, bring about more effective process, wider examination coverage, and eventually, higher quality software application. This short article looks into the myriad means AI is improving the future of software screening, from intelligent test case generation to predictive flaw evaluation.
The assimilation of AI into the software application testing lifecycle isn't about changing human testers; instead, it's about augmenting their capacities and automating repeated, time-consuming tasks, freeing them to concentrate on more complicated and exploratory screening initiatives. By harnessing the logical power of AI, groups can attain a new level of effectiveness and effectiveness in their software screening and quality control processes.
The Complex Impact of AI on Test Monitoring.
AI's influence penetrates various elements of test monitoring, providing options to enduring obstacles and opening new possibilities:.
1. Intelligent Test Case Generation and Optimization:.
One of the most substantial bottlenecks in software testing is the creation and maintenance of extensive test cases. AI-powered test case software and test case writing tools can examine needs, customer stories, and existing code to instantly create relevant and effective test cases. Moreover, AI formulas can identify repetitive or low-value test cases, enhancing the test suite for much better coverage with fewer examinations. This intelligent method streamlines the test case management procedure and makes certain that testing initiatives are concentrated on one of the most crucial locations of the application.
2. Smart Test Automation:.
Examination automation is already a keystone of contemporary software growth, however AI takes it to the next degree. Automated software application testing devices and automated testing tools boosted with AI can learn from past examination executions, determine patterns, and adapt to adjustments in the application under test a lot more intelligently. Automated qa testing powered by AI can also examine test results, identify origin of failings more effectively, and even self-heal test scripts, minimizing maintenance expenses. This development results in more durable and resilient automatic qa screening.
3. Predictive Issue Analysis:.
AI algorithms can examine historical issue data, code modifications, and other relevant metrics to predict locations of the software program that are more than likely to have insects. This aggressive technique allows screening groups to focus their initiatives on risky locations early in the growth cycle, causing earlier defect detection and minimized rework. This anticipating capacity significantly enhances the efficiency of qa screening and enhances overall software program top quality.
4. Intelligent Examination Execution and Prioritization:.
AI can optimize examination implementation by dynamically focusing on test cases based upon aspects like code changes, threat assessment, and previous failure patterns. This makes certain that the most important tests are implemented first, test case writing tools providing faster responses on the security and top quality of the software. AI-driven examination monitoring tools can additionally smartly choose the most appropriate test environments and data for each and every test run.
5. Enhanced Problem Administration:.
Incorporating AI with jira examination administration devices and various other examination administration tools can change defect management. AI can automatically categorize and prioritize flaws based upon their intensity, frequency, and impact. It can additionally determine potential replicate problems and also suggest possible source, accelerating the debugging process for designers.
6. Boosted Examination Environment Administration:.
Setting up and handling test environments can be complicated and time-consuming. AI can aid in automating the provisioning and arrangement of test atmospheres, ensuring consistency and minimizing arrangement time. AI-powered tools can likewise check setting health and wellness and determine potential concerns proactively.
7. Natural Language Processing (NLP) for Demands and Test Cases:.
NLP, a subset of AI, can be made use of to analyze software application needs written in natural language, recognize obscurities or disparities, and also instantly produce initial test cases based upon these demands. This can considerably boost the clearness and testability of needs and simplify the test case management software program process.
Navigating the Landscape of AI-Powered Examination Management Tools.
The market for AI testing devices and automated software screening devices with AI capacities is swiftly increasing. Organizations have a expanding variety of options to select from, including:.
AI-Enhanced Test Automation Frameworks: Existing qa automation tools and frameworks are progressively integrating AI attributes for intelligent test generation, self-healing, and result analysis.
Devoted AI Testing Operatings systems: These systems leverage AI algorithms across the whole screening lifecycle, from needs evaluation to flaw prediction.
Integration with Existing Examination Administration Solutions: Lots of test monitoring platforms are incorporating with AI-powered tools to boost their existing performances, such as intelligent examination prioritization and defect analysis.
When picking examination management tools in software application testing with AI capacities, it's important to consider elements like simplicity of combination with existing systems (like Jira test case administration), the certain AI functions provided, the learning contour for the group, and the general cost-effectiveness. Discovering cost-free test administration devices or free test case administration tools with restricted AI attributes can be a good beginning factor for recognizing the possible benefits.
The Human Element Remains Vital.
While AI uses significant capacity to enhance examination monitoring, it's necessary to bear in mind that human expertise stays crucial. AI-powered tools are effective aides, but they can not change the important reasoning, domain name understanding, and exploratory screening abilities of human qa screening professionals. The most effective strategy entails a joint collaboration in between AI and human testers, leveraging the strengths of both to achieve exceptional software top quality.
Accepting the Future of Quality Control.
The combination of AI right into examination monitoring is not simply a fad; it's a fundamental change in just how companies come close to software testing and quality control. By welcoming AI testing devices and tactically integrating AI right into their process, teams can attain considerable renovations in effectiveness, coverage, and the general high quality of their software program. As AI remains to advance, its role in shaping the future of software test management devices and the wider qa automation landscape will only become extra profound. Organizations that proactively explore and embrace these innovative technologies will be well-positioned to supply high-quality software application much faster and more dependably in the competitive online digital age. The trip in the direction of AI-enhanced examination administration is an financial investment in the future of software application high quality, promising a brand-new age of effectiveness and effectiveness in the search of perfect applications.